The only litters I nominate are the one's that I'm planning to keep a trial prospect or two out of. So far the only puppies I'm raising that are getting trialed in AKC or NGSPA are the one's I keep so other than feeding the pot it doesnt' make much sense to do otherwise. If I don't think a pup from a given litter is likely to be run in the futurity it would just be like sending in my entry fees to trials I'm planning on not attending or running dogs in.
I have a couple of breedings coming up soon though that definitely will be as well as a couple on the ground now. CR

We have nominated most all of our litters for the GSPCA and when we sell them to owners we know will do both, we do the NGSPA as well. I had often thought what are the chances that this will actually pay off... well I can tell you it only takes ONE to convince you that it is worth it. When Wildfeather's Face the Music won, it was a litter we produced (right be CR bought Cleo from us
) and it was definately worth taking the chance on! I have also been able to introduce some new prospects by telling them this pup will be futurity nominated and explaining what goes with it! Soyou never know you might not produce the winner, but you might gain some new people to the sport as well.
We have a litter due in mid Oct that will be nominated (a Magnum X Kate female bred to Cutter) the first breeding of them is nominated for next years futurity! And our Kessie X Buck male will be nominated as well.
